There’s a reason why we call Kerala God’s Own Country; the natural beauty of the
There’s a reason why we call Kerala God’s Own Country; the natural beauty of the
Kerala boasts immeasurable beauty, and Alappuzha, or Alleppey, epitomises that. Often regarded as the ‘Venice
Whether you are a tourist or a traveller (whatever that’s supposed to mean), Kerala is
What Makes It Awesome As a Malayali, this writer has heard from his parents, other